Template:Sample/styles.css

.collectionsample {
	text-align: center;
	float: right;
	margin-left: 1ex;
	padding: .6ex;
	border: 1px solid #a2a9b1;
	color: var(--color-base);
	background-color: var(--background-color-base);
}
.collectionsample-header {
	font-weight: bold;
}
@media (max-width: 719px) {
	.collectionsample {
		float: none;
		margin: 0;
		box-sizing: border-box;
		width: 100% !important; /* override inline CSS */
	}
}